AI-Generated Review

What is Essence-public?

Essence-public delivers a free, native macOS log viewer that turns messy log files into scannable views with regex-based token highlighting, a minimap for quick navigation (gutter, previews, time-of-day viz), and "lenses" – JS tooltips that fetch data like local time from UTC timestamps or MAC vendor names via external APIs. Built for macOS 14+ as a lightweight 5MB sandboxed app, it tackles the pain of sifting through dense logs without the bloat of full IDEs or browser tools. Download the DMG, drop it in Applications, and import YAML profiles for instant setup.

Why is it gaining traction?

It skips Electron heft for true native speed, packs a minimap and issue panel for filtering errors fast, and lets you script dynamic lenses with JS and sync fetches – think resolving user IDs or vendors on hover, no plugins needed. Unlike Console.app or tail -f hacks, this focuses purely on logs with exportable profiles, hooking devs who want zero-setup power.

Who should use this?

Backend engineers on Macs parsing service logs daily, sysadmins tracking system events with custom timezones or device lookups, or QA folks hunting bugs in app outputs without firing up VS Code.

Verdict

At 13 stars and 1.0% credibility, Essence-public feels like an early alpha – solid README with regex examples and lens demos, but no tests or broad community yet. Grab it if you're on Mac and need lightweight log smarts with JS extensibility; skip for production unless you contribute lenses yourself.
